The committee of Solvane Maritime reviewed exposure arising from charter revenues denominated in foreign currency against costs incurred at the Kellbrook yard. Treasurer Ines Marrow presented three hedging options: full forward cover, a 60% rolling hedge, and options-based protection. After discussion, the committee recommended the 60% rolling hedge for twelve months, subject to quarterly review. The board is asked to ratify this at its next sitting. For context on strategic assumptions, the confidential planning note follows below.

management briefing: Project Juleth slips by two quarters because of the audit delay.

Team,

During next week's disaster-recovery drill at the Fennwick site, the Tidelark sweeper will be deliberately severed from its primary state store. Expect it to flag every resource as orphaned for roughly ten minutes — do not approve any deletion batches during that window. Once the drill coordinator confirms cutover, restart the sweeper in reconciliation mode and verify the quarantine queue drains cleanly. To unlock the sweeper's sealed recovery store, you will need the passphrase provided directly below this message.

vault phrase of tajef-tafog = istox-sorax-zorox-casok-holox-kelix-weneth-drueth-casion

## Deployment

Gridnook runs behind the Tollway load balancer, which polls each instance's health endpoint before routing traffic. The check distinguishes liveness from readiness: a failed readiness probe drains the instance gracefully, while repeated liveness failures trigger replacement. When deploying, keep the drain window longer than the longest in-flight request, or users will see dropped connections. Future maintainers should not change thresholds casually. The health-check parameters currently in effect are listed below.

settings of bawif-fawif:
ralix:
  log_level: warn
  metrics_host: metrics.ralix.tolvaqsys.internal
  pool_size: 32

# Basement Archive Room — Night Access

The archive room under Pellworth House holds old contracts and the tape backups. Night shift: take stairwell C, not the lift (it's switched off after midnight). Lights are on a timer by the door — slap the button as you go in. Sign the logbook, even at 3am, yes really. The keypad by the door takes the code below.

staff pass of fahap-tajeg = bdg-FT-6